dis·ap·point·ed
/%dIsJ'pOIntId/
adjective
kecéwa
▪ [+ (at sth)]
I was bitterly disappointed at the result of the test.
Saya sangat kecéwa dengan hasil tés itu.
▪ [+ (by sth)]
She was disappointed by the quality of the product.
Dia kecéwa dengan kualitas produk itu.
▪ [+ (in sb/sth)]
His father is disappointed in him.
Ayahnya kecéwa padanya.
▪ [+ (with sb/sth)]
He was very disappointed with himself.
Dia sangat kecéwa dengan dirinya sendiri.
▪ [+ (to see, hear, etc.)]
He was disappointed to hear the news.
Dia kecéwa mendengar berita itu.
▪ [+ (that …)]
I’m disappointed (that) he didn’t turn up.
Saya kecéwa karena dia tidak muncul.
▪ [+ (not) to]
She was disappointed not to be elected.
Dia kecéwa karena tidak terpilih.
